It consisted of Object Oriented, PHP, SQL & Linux command questions. They mostly wanted a person who knew PHP & SQL, which I didn't. I had edited some stuff on PHP but never created anything. And in SQL, I took a one semester class which I had forgotten most of it already. It was a half an hour long question session through the phone. Some of the questions were:
-Why in Java does it require "static" in the main function?
-What's a static function?
-What's outer & inner join in SQL?
-Give me a SQL statement that returns the count of number of rows.
-How do you sort by / group by?
-What are sessions in PHP?
-What are double $$ in PHP?
-What are the following Linux commands: more, less, pipe, grep (also a problem involving grep)?

I had the first round of interview with the Manager for about 45 to 50 mins. After 3 weeks, I had the second round of interview with one of the developers. It was an online coding test mostly concentrating on Javascript and one question involving algorithms and data structures. The next business day I got a mail from the Talent Acquisition team asking me to come onsite for an interview. The onsite interview went on for about 4 and a half hours with about 5 mins of break. It was mostly white board coding and tested my skills in HTML, CSS and Javascript. It also involved some problem solving and puzzle kind of questions. The last round of onsite interview was with the manager which went on for about an hour and 15 mins.
The only negative thing about the whole process was, after spending so much effort and time travelling and preparing for the interview, PayPal doesn't even bother to give the feedback. 2 Days after the onsite interview I got a mail saying they are considering other applicants for this position, but they don't bother telling you what was the feedback from the interview panel despite my repeated emails.
